What does a Data Input Operator do?
Data entry administrators enter a variety of information into databases using various software packages and assist colleagues in retrieving information.
Tasks required include:
- Enters customers' personal details and other Information into a database using the appropriate software.
- Transfers paper-based information into electronic databases.
- Updates records, such as sales or patient data.
- Updates website product descriptions and details.
- Assists other employees and/or customers in accessing information.
- Analyses data to identify trends and patterns.
What are the entry requirements for a Data Input Operator?
There are no minimum academic requirements, although GCSEs/S grades or equivalent qualifications may be useful. Entrants are expected to have relevant experience and some employers require minimum typing speeds. On-the-job training is often provided. Relevant vocational qualifications such as NVQs in administration and apprenticeships are available.
